And since they’re made in a 9×13 inch pan – you don’t even need to go out and buy a springform.They start of with a graham cracker base – which I like to bake first because that way you get a crunchier crust.Then the cheesecake layer is smooth, creamy & just all around plain amazing.
Adding sour cream in addition to the cream cheese makes the cake silky smooth. Then I added 2 tablespoons of flour to the batter to reduce the chance of cheesecake cracks.

(This helps bind everything together).For this recipe, I like to bake the cheesecake at 325F degrees. Cooking a cheesecake slowly at a lower temperature helps to keep moisture in and leaves your cheesecake silky smooth.Then it’s super important to cool the cheesecake slowly. If a cheesecake cools too quickly, it increases the risk of cheesecake cracks. When the cheesecake is done baking I like to:. Turn off the oven & open the oven door.

Cool the cheesecake in the oven with the door open for at least 30 minutes. Then continue cooling on the counter and the cheesecake & pan are room temperature.
Cover and place in the fridge to chill.For the topping, we’re making sugared strawberries with fresh berries.
